What Causes Excessive Crankcase Pressure in Engines?

Excessive crankcase pressure is often caused by a blocked or malfunctioning Positive Crankcase Ventilation (PCV) valve, worn piston rings, or blow-by gas escaping past the pistons. This can lead to oil leaks, reduced engine performance, and potential engine damage. Regular maintenance and timely inspections of the PCV valve and piston components can help mitigate these issues.

  1. What is excessive crankcase pressure? Excessive crankcase pressure occurs when pressure inside the engine's crankcase builds up beyond normal levels, often due to blocked ventilation or piston wear.
  2. How does a faulty PCV valve cause crankcase pressure problems? A malfunctioning PCV valve can block the ventilation of gases from the crankcase, leading to pressure buildup that may cause oil leaks and engine performance issues.
  3. Can worn piston rings lead to excessive crankcase pressure? Yes, worn piston rings allow blow-by gases to escape into the crankcase, increasing pressure and potentially damaging engine components.
  4. How can I reduce excessive crankcase pressure in my vehicle? Regularly inspect and replace the PCV valve, maintain piston rings, and ensure timely engine servicing to prevent excessive crankcase pressure.
